      2011., Adult, Little, Brown and company Call No: MYS Fic Con   Edition: 1st ed.    Availability:1 of 1     At Your Library Series Title: Mickey Haller   Volume: 4Summary Note: Mickey Haller has fallen on tough times. He expands his business into foreclosure defense, only to see one of his clients accused of killing the banker she blames for trying to take away her home. Mickey puts his team into high gear to exonerate Lisa Trammel, even though the evidence and his own suspicions tell him his client is guilty. Soon after he learns that the victim had black market dealings of his own, Haller is assaulted, too, and he's certain he's on the right trail.

      2010., Little, Brown and company Call No: LP Fic Con   Edition: Large print ed.    Availability:1 of 1     At Your Library Series Title: Mickey Haller   Volume: 3Summary Note: After 24 years in prison, convicted killer Jason Jessup has been exonerated by new DNA evidence. Longtime defense attorney Mickey Haller is convinced Jessup is guilty, and he takes the case on the condition that he gets to choose his investigator, LAPD Detective Harry Bosch. Together, Bosch and Haller set off on a case fraught with political and personal danger. Opposing them is Jessup, now out on bail, a defense attorney who excels at manipulating the media, and a runaway eyewitness reluctant to testify after so many years.
